Belize and El Salvador have very similar overall Warnely composite scores: 34 and 34. The choice between them is unlikely to be driven by the headline number alone. The biggest single category gap is in crime, where Belize scores 2/5 against El Salvador's 3/5. The US State Department currently carries a Level 2 advisory on Belize and a Level 1 on El Salvador. Drug law diverges sharply: El Salvador carries a tier-severe regime against Belize's more permissive framework.
